风哥教程

培训 . 交流 . 分享
Make progress together!

Linux_Oracle11g数据库安装报错cannot restore segment prot after reloc: ...

[复制链接]
内容发布:风哥| 发布时间:2013-12-24 11:58:12
环境:
Redhat Linux AS5.7 +Oracle 11.2.0.1 X86_64位环境

安装完Oracle11.2.0.1后,通过netca创建监听程序,然后执行lsnrctl status,报错如下:

[oracle @bt bin]#lsnrctl status
./lsnrctl: error while loading shared libraries: /oracle/ora11g/product/11.2.0/dbhome_1/lib/libclntsh.so.11.1: cannot restore segment prot after reloc: Permission denied

解决过程如下:

[root@bt bin]#semanage fcontext -a -t textrel_shlib_t /oracle/ora11g/product/11.2.0/dbhome_1/lib/libclntsh.so.11.1

    csvn homedir /opt/CollabNet_Subversion or its parent directory conflicts with a defined context in /etc/selinux/targeted/contexts/files/file_contexts, /usr/sbin/genhomedircon will not create a new context. This usually indicates an incorrectly defined system account. If it is a system account please make sure its login shell is /sbin/nologin.

[root@bt bin]# restorecon -R -v /oracle/ora11g/product/11.2.0/dbhome_1/lib/libclntsh.so.11.1

    restorecon reset /home/mnum/app/mnum/product/11.2.0/dbhome_1/lib/libclntsh.so.11.1 context user_u:object_r:user_home_t:s0->system_u:object_r:textrel_shlib_t:s0


重新执行lsnrctl status,问题解决。




上一篇:【BBED】bbed工具安装(oracle10g,oracle11g)
下一篇:关于Oracle数据库:Warning The SCN headroom for this database is only N days
专业提供Oracle/MySQL/NoSQL/Linux数据库培训与技术支持服务,QQ号:113257174
关注风哥教程微信公众号itpux_com  ,了解本站最新技术资料的分享.

欢迎加QQ群,提供超多高质量Oracle/Unix/Linux技术文档与视频教程的下载。

Oracle/MySQL/Linux群4-5:189070296  150201289  
Oracle/MySQL/Linux群6-8:244609803   522261684   522651731
备注:请勿重复加群,另请注明 from itpux
回复

使用道具 举报

1框架
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

热门文章教程

  • 大数据技术与应用入门培训教程(电子版下载
  • Oracle 12cR2 九大新功能全面曝光_详解云数
  • Oracle OCP认证考试IZ0-053题库共712题数据
  • MySQL5权威指南(第3版)PDF电子版下载
  • 风哥Oracle数据库巡检工具V1.0(附2.6网页
  • Oracle19c数据库发布与下载地址
快速回复 返回顶部 返回列表